What would be important for someone to know about working with you?
I strive to work from an intersectional lens, looking at how every aspect of who you are and the life you've lived interacts with one another. I work alongside my clients to create an environment where they feel secure to examine parts of themselves that can produce uncomfortable feelings. I enjoy helping my clients, whether individually or in couples therapy, to learn how to best advocate for themselves, their needs, and their desires. One of my favorite aspects of my job is normalizing things to help reduce self-doubt, shame, and isolation.

Work HistoryAfter graduating with my master's in Clinical Mental Health Counseling in December of 2020, I went on to complete most of my residency at The Pincus Center before opening up my private practice, Fox and Owl Psychotherapy, with AJ Cheyfitz in October 2023. I completed my residency and became a Licensed Professional Counselor (LPC) in September 2024.
